Description
Technical field
The utility model belongs to the Bending Processing field of sheet metal component, be specifically related to a kind of opening adjustable without impression bender lower die.
Background technology
Adjustable counterdie is the conventional mould in panel beating bending field, by regulating its opening size, is applicable to the plate of bending different-thickness and different angles, applied range.The adjustable lower die structure of insert block type conventional is at present as follows: die holder position is fixed, and inserted block is furnished with a series of size, and be of a size of lower die open size between two counterdie mold inserts, lower die open size regulates by the inserted block taking different size.Insert block type is adjustable, and counterdie technical requirement is relatively low, produces easily, but operation takes time and effort, and production efficiency is low.Meanwhile, in traditional Bending Processing process, the friction between workpiece and lower mold body is static friction, and this just causes surface of the work and produces impression and scratch owing to being squeezed, thus affects presentation quality and the precision of workpiece.
Utility model content
The purpose of this utility model is to provide a kind of bar folder counterdie be convenient to regulate openings of sizes, can avoided again sheet metal component produces impression simultaneously.

Detailed description of the invention
As shown in Figure 1, 2, a kind of bender lower die, comprise die holder 10, described die holder 10 upper surface is provided with two modules 11 upwards protruded out, described two modules 11 are arranged symmetrically with about this die holder 10 center line, be split-type structural between described two modules 11 and die holder 10, and two modules 11 are slidably arranged in and die holder 10 make two modules 11 form open-close type to arrange; Described die holder 10 is also provided with the locking unit for module 11 being fixed on arbitrary distance of run position.
Preferably, described die holder 10 upper surface offers T-slot 13, is provided with slide 12 bottom described module 11, and described slide 12 to be stuck in T-slot 13 and to slide along T-slot 13 length direction, described T-slot 13 two ends are provided with baffle plate 16, and described baffle plate 16 is fixed by screws on die holder 10 side; Described module 11 is connected by longitudinal bolt 14 with between slide 12, is provided with stage clip 15 between described module 11 bottom surface and slide 12 upper surface.
Further, described die holder 10 upper surface and module 11 lower surface are processed as coarse tooth bar face, and the tooth bar length direction in this tooth bar face is vertical with the length direction of T-slot 13.
The utility model adopts prefastening bolt 13 stuck-module 11, makes to realize adjustable being fixedly connected with between module 11 with die holder 10, arranges tooth bar face on die holder 10 with the contact surface of module 11 simultaneously, ensures that module 11 can not produce loosening in matched moulds process.
Further, be provided with roller 121 bottom described slide 12, the axis horizontal of this roller 121 is arranged and the bottom surface that the wheel face of roller 121 protrudes slide 12 is arranged.
Further, the inside corner place of described two module 11 upper surfaces is provided with roller bearing 17, and the axis of described roller bearing 17 is arranged along this comer edge line, and described roller bearing 17 is stuck in along in the deep-slotted chip breaker of this comer edge place setting.
Preferably, be provided with pressing plate 18 above described deep-slotted chip breaker, described pressing plate 18 is provided with the arcwall face coordinated with roller bearing 17, and described pressing plate 18 is fixed by screws in module 11; The two ends of described roller bearing 17 are provided with back-up ring 19, and described back-up ring 19 is fixed by screws on module 11 side, and back-up ring 19 and roller bearing 17 end face are fitted the axial limiting formed roller bearing 17.
The utility model arranges roller bearing at module inside corner place, and sheet metal component is in the process of bending, and rolling friction replaces static friction in the past, avoids impression appears in panel beating.
Operation principle of the present utility model is as follows:
Unclamp connecting bolt 13, spring 15 jack-up module 11, module 11 is thrown off with the toothed surface of die holder 10, push module 11 along the horizontal relative movement of die holder 10, reaches the object regulating mould openings by slide 12.After mould openings is adjusted to suitable width, fastened die block 11 and the connecting bolt 13 of slide 12, make module 11 be fastened with the toothed surface of die holder 10, realize mould openings and fix spacing object.The working face Machining Arc groove of another module 11, in arc groove, roller bearing 17 is installed, fixed by pressing plate 18, when adopting above-mentioned bending lower die to carry out Bending Processing to sheet metal, workpiece only contacts with the roller bearing 17 on lower module 11 in whole Forging Process, and roller bearing 17 can rotate along the moving direction of sheet material, make workpiece with lower mold body contact after become present rolling friction from traditional static friction, thus eliminate the impression and scratch that surface of the work produces owing to being squeezed, effectively improve presentation quality and the precision of workpiece.
